Modulation of NMDA receptor signaling and zinc chelation prevent seizure-like events in a zebrafish model of SLC13A5 epilepsy

Mutations in the SLC13A5 citrate transporter have been linked to epilepsy in humans. In this study the authors generate a new zebrafish model of slc13a5 epilepsy and reveal that in this model, excessive extracellular citrate chelates zinc ions that regulate N…
